Cloud computing has revolutionized delivery of IT solutions increasing economic advantages, robustness, scalability, elasticity and security. Nowadays to achieve their cloud goals, organizations are increasingly move towards enabling multi-cloud environments which promised to support very large-scale, worldwide, distributed applications using multiple and independent cloud environments. However, given their complexity and distribution, multi-cloud has to face several key challenges around security and governance such as interoperability, portability, provisioning, elasticity, high availability and security. Therefore, these challenges increase the needs of security governance in such environments. Although some researches have been realized in the multi-cloud security domain, it becomes imperative to asses the current state of research and practice of its security governance. This paper aims to categorize the existing works related to security governance in multi-cloud environments by applying a systematic mapping study methodology in order toidentify trends and future directions. Our results prove that multi-clouds security governance seems to be a promising areain multi-cloud research and evaluation. |
